Wrestling



Beginners will learn the fundamentals, while more experienced wrestlers will receive a high level of instruction, including live drilling sessions. While there will be no dual meets, we will host an individual tournament at the end of camp. Wrestling Camp takes place on Darlington School’s 400-acre, college-preparatory campus, complete with a 96,000-square foot athletic center, natatorium, weight room, running trails, air-conditioned dormitories and the best camp food imaginable.

About the directors


Kelly McDurmon teaches and coaches at Darlington’s Upper School, and has been involved in the school’s youth wrestling program since its inception six years ago. His wrestling background began at age 12, so he understands the importance of developing fundamental skills at an early age. As a high school wrestler, McDurmon was a member of three state championship squads. He earned three area championships and two state titles as an individual in the late 80s. After graduating from Berry College, he coached his alma mater to two team state championships 2002 and 2003. McDurmon has coached in 25 state championship matches, helping his athletes win 14 state titles.

Wesley Styles graduated magna cum laude from Shorter University in 2001 with a B.S. in Chemistry. In 2010 he received a M.A. in Leadership from Shorter University. Currently he is pursuing his Ed. S. in Educational Leadership at Berry College. He has 10 years of experience teaching and nine years of experience as the head coach of Rome High School. In 2004, he was named STAR Teacher. He currently teaches the Physics First classes at Darlington Upper School. He has coached five state champions and numerous state placers in his time as head coach. Recently one of his former wrestlers finished 5th at the NAIA national tournament. Coach Styles loves coaching wrestling because he feels that it teaches young men the value of hard work and perseverance.
